Shen Kuo, courtesy name Cunzhong. Due to his father's official position, he enjoyed the favor of the court and served as the official registrar of Shuyang County

After passing the Jinshi examination, he was assigned to compile and proofread Zhao Wen Guan's books were collated and deleted.

The regulations of the three departments were established. According to the custom, the emperor went to the circular hill in the southern suburbs every three years to offer sacrifices to heaven and earth.

It is arranged by the relevant agencies according to the records in the classics, and then the copies are collected. The clerks often seek personal gain through the ceremony

. Before the sacrifice, a tent is set up under the altar, and several tents are set up outside the palace.

Build gardens in the place, plant trees, decorate them with colorful colors, carve birds and animals, and place them continuously among the trees.

On the evening of the day when the sacrifice was about to be held, the emperor personally Come and enjoy the garden scenery, go up to the south gate of Duanmen

, display the honor guard, inspect the troops guarding the martial law, and tour and enjoy the sights. These are not things that should be done during fasting

Sacrifice Scene. Each utensil used by the emperor required sixty or seventy craftsmen to make.

Shen Kuo examined the development and changes of the ritual system and wrote a book "Southern Jiao Style". The imperial court then ordered him to take charge of the suburbs

Sacrifice matters were handled according to the new etiquette. In this way, tens of thousands of dollars were saved each time. Song Shenzong

was very satisfied.

Soon after, Shen Kuo He was promoted to Prince Zhongyun, inspected the Zhongshu execution room, and promoted to the Tianjian. At that time, the officials in charge of astronomy and calendars were all mediocre people who had no knowledge of the phenomena, images and observations of celestial bodies. Equipment,

almost knew nothing about it. After Shen Kuo was promoted to the Tianjian, he installed an armillary sphere, a landscape table, and five pots and leaks, and

recruited Wei Pu to compile a new calendar. , collecting books from all over the world for observing astronomical phenomena used by Taishi. In addition, he also appointed scholars in the Tianjian of Si

and divided the science of alchemy into five categories. These methods were later adopted.

A famine occurred in Huainan, and the imperial court sent Shen Kuo to inspect and investigate. After he arrived in Huainan, he ordered the distribution of money and grain for regular liquidation of warehouses. At the same time, he organized the construction of rivers and canals and the repair of barren fields. To eliminate the difficulties caused by floods

Subsequently, he was promoted to Jixian School Manager and was ordered to inspect and investigate the farmland water conservancy situation in the two Zhejiang areas.

At that time, the imperial court collected a large number of private vehicles. , people didn’t understand what the officials meant, and they were all worried; the City Council was worried that Sichuan would not be able to ban smugglers in selling salt and making huge profits, so they wanted to fill up all the private salt wells and transport

Remove the salt from the pond to solve the salt problem in Sichuan. There were as many memorials discussing these two things as yarn on a loom

, but they did not explain the problem clearly. Shen Kuo stood there Next to Shenzong, Shenzong looked at him and said: "Do you

know about collecting vehicles?" Shen Kuo replied: "Yes." Shenzong asked: "How is this matter?"

Shen Kuo said: "What is the purpose of collecting the vehicles?" Shenzong said: "The Liao army in the north uses horses to win. Without vehicles, it is impossible to resist them." Shen Kuo said: "The vehicles fight. The benefits can be seen in all dynasties

However, the military chariots mentioned by the ancients are light vehicles with five horses to pull them, which is conducive to rapid march.

Now among the people The heavy-duty truck was huge and heavy and could not travel thirty miles a day, so people called it a 'flat truck' and it was only for daily use." Shenzong said happily: "What others have said I didn't mention this.

I want to think about it carefully." Asked him again about Sichuan salt, he replied: "fill all the private salt wells

and transport them. It would be good to remove the salt from the prefecture and make the salt sold by the government. However, Zhongzhou, Wanzhou,

Rongzhou, and Luzhou are areas where ethnic minorities live. There are many small salt wells, so it cannot be done all at once. If they are forbidden

, people must be sent to guard them. In this way, I am afraid that the gains outweigh the losses." Shenzong nodded,

thinking it was right. The next day, both things happened. It stopped. Then Shen Kuo was promoted to Zhizhigao, and also in charge of Tongjin.

Intai Division. It had only been three months since he was promoted to the position of Prince Zhongyun. Then Shen Kuo took up the post again< /p>

Liao Kingdom Xiao Xilai argued about the Huangwei area in Hedong Province and stayed in the hotel and refused to resign, saying: "I must achieve my goal before I can return." Shenzong sent Shen Kuo as an envoy to the Liao Kingdom. Shen Kuo went to the Privy Council Looking through the archives

of the past, I found documents that agreed on the border in previous years. The document specified the ancient Great Wall as the border.

But the place we are fighting for now is thirty years apart from the Great Wall. Liyuan, he went to the table to discuss the matter. Shenzong specially opened the Tianzhang Pavilion during the holiday and summoned Shen Kuo to make his statement. After hearing this, Shenzong said happily: "Ministers, this is not the case." >

I didn’t explore the whole story, and almost missed the important national event." So Shenzong ordered that the map

be shown to Xiao Xi. Xiao Xili stopped arguing because he was poor in words. Shenzong rewarded Shen Kuo with a thousand taels of platinum and asked him to set off for the Liao Kingdom. When he arrived at the Khitan court, the Khitan Prime Minister Yang Yijie came to interview him. Shen Kuo found him and argued with him

There were dozens of land documents, and he asked the clerks and staff to memorize them in advance. Yang Yijie asked the question, and Shen Kuo asked the clerk to answer it with examples. When he asked it again another day, he still gave the same answer. Yang Yijie Having nothing to say

he said arrogantly: "You are not willing to give up even a few miles away. Do you want to easily break off the reconciliation between the two countries?" Shen Kuo said: " If the troops are sent with reason, morale will be high; if there is no reason, morale will be low. Now you

the Northern Dynasty have abandoned the great oath of your former emperor and used violence to enslave your people. This is not good for us

< p>The Song Dynasty had no disadvantages." The General Secretary met six times. The Khitan side knew that Shen Kuo would not yield to his will, so they ignored the Huangwei area and only requested that the Tianchi area be divided They returned to them. Shen Kuo then set out to return to the dynasty.

On the road, he drew the steepness and gentleness of the mountains and rivers, the twists and turns of the road, the simplicity and complexity of the customs, and the beauty of the people's hearts. Supported and dissatisfied, he wrote a book "Essential Khitan Illustrations" and dedicated it to the imperial court. The imperial court appointed him

He was a Hanlin scholar and the third envoy of Quan.

After the generals Jing Siyi and Qu Zhen captured the Moya, Jialu and Futu cities of Xixia, Shen Kuo proposed to build a stone fort to deal with Xixia. However, When Xu Xi arrived during the incident, he wanted to build Yongle City first. The imperial court ordered Xu

Xu Xi to direct the generals to build the city, and ordered Shen Kuo to move his commander's palace to the border to provide military supplies

He sent troops to rescue. Soon, Xu Xi failed and died in battle. Shen Kuo went to rescue Suide first because the Xixia army attacked Suide. Therefore, he was unable to rescue Yongle City and was demoted to Junzhou Tuanlian. Deputy envoy. In the early years of Yuanyou, he was reassigned to Xiuzhou for resettlement. Then, he was appointed as Guanglu Shaoqing, received his salary in Nanjing, and lived in Runzhou.

Died eight years later at the age of sixty-five.

Shen Kuo was knowledgeable and good at writing articles. He had no knowledge of astronomy, local chronicles, laws and calendars, music, medicine, and divination

He also recorded the things he usually discussed with his guests and wrote them in the book "Bi Tan", which recorded many allusions, facts, and stories of old ministers in the court. Situation

Situation, spread in the world.
